Output ec882a8b7e3862c75cbc1e44f8fb511eaaaef14f0d70fe32eebf7dec21198c95:4

value
156074
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be52d00a3e8890c9110bd4a895dbac508b2e54f6 OP_EQUAL
address
3K3MWv4ts4NwN5ShceDwkDp9kH1rZfiWFx
transaction
ec882a8b7e3862c75cbc1e44f8fb511eaaaef14f0d70fe32eebf7dec21198c95
confirmations
95526
spent
true